def _verified_download(self, firmware: Firmware, hash_firmware: str,
                        max_attempts: int) -> bool:
     """
     Downloads the given Firmware and checks if the download was correct and if the hash is matching
     :param firmware:
     :param hash_firmware:
     :param max_attempts: max number of attemps to download a firmware
     :return: bool
     """
     valid_download = False
     count = 0
     while (not valid_download) & (count < max_attempts):
         valid_download = self._download_file(firmware.url, firmware.file,
                                              firmware.release_model)
         if valid_download:
             valid_download = firmware.check_hash(hash_firmware)
         count += 1
     if count >= max_attempts:
         Logger().debug(
             "[-] The Firmware(" + firmware.name +
             ") couldn't be downloaded", 3)
         return False
     else:
         Logger().debug(
             "[+] The Firmware(" + firmware.name +
             ") was successfully downloaded", 3)
         return True
